Kaus Media, fixed star of Jupiter and Mars in Sagittarius, carries ambition, spiritual measure, and the call to lead with generosity near 4°35 Capricorn.

At the wrist of the Archer's drawing hand, Kaus Media occupies a precise and purposeful position within the constellation of Sagittarius — the middle star of the bow, caught between the tension of release and the discipline of aim. Its planetary nature blends Jupiter and Mars: the expansive, philosophically charged energy of the greater benefic married to the driven, sometimes combative force of the red planet. That pairing alone tells you a great deal — this is a star of directed ambition, where vision must be tempered by measure, and where force, left ungoverned, turns inward.

Its tropical longitude sits in the early degrees of Capricorn — a placement that already colours it with the Saturnian themes of structure, responsibility, and the long climb. Fixed stars precess slowly through the zodiac at roughly one degree every seventy-two years, so no single degree can be declared permanently exact; what matters is the conjunction, the moment a planet or angle in a natal chart draws close enough — within approximately 1° orb — to activate this star's symbolism.

The Archer's Middle Bow

In Chinese astronomical tradition, Kaus Media was known as the Domicile of the Bushel, a name that carries an immediate moral instruction: keep just measure. The bushel is neither overflowing nor empty — it is calibrated, honest, sufficient. That image of careful stewardship runs through every layer of this star's meaning. Air is its esoteric element in Nicole Bartolucci's stellar system, and its colour is yellow — the hue of intellect, of sunlight filtered through thought, of a mind that seeks to understand before it acts.

The Sagittarian archetype is already oriented upward, toward the horizon, toward meaning. Kaus Media sharpens that orientation into something more demanding: not merely the desire to aim high, but the obligation to understand what the sky is asking of you. There is a spiritual dimension here that cannot be bypassed in favour of material success alone. The star can bring genuine worldly honours — recognition, status, the fruits of ambition — but it presents these as a threshold, not a destination. Cross them without inner work, and they hollow out.

Ambition and Its Measure

The Jupiter-Mars blend produces a natural leader, someone whose energy draws others into motion. There are memories encoded in this star — Bartolucci calls them memories of the tribal chief, of the one who bore collective responsibility and, in some past configuration, may have set it down too soon, yielded to fear, abandoned the enterprise. This is not a condemnation but a karmic thread: the soul that carries Kaus Media prominently in its chart is invited to pick up that thread consciously, to accept leadership not as privilege but as service.

Ambition without generosity is merely appetite. Kaus Media asks that the arrow, once drawn, be released for something larger than the archer.

The shadow of this star is legible in the same Jupiter-Mars tension. Mars without Jupiter becomes aggression; Jupiter without Mars becomes grandiosity. When the balance tips, there is a tendency toward a contained violence that can, if unexamined, redirect itself against its own source — a self-sabotage dressed as strength. The Chinese image of the bushel returns here as a warning: too much force, poorly managed, spills over the edge.

How It Works in a Chart

Because Kaus Media is a fixed star, it operates outside the zodiac wheel entirely. It does not rule a sign, does not participate in aspects between planets in the conventional sense. Its influence becomes active — and can become decisive — only when a natal planet or angle falls within approximately 1° of its tropical position near 4°35 Capricorn. The closer the conjunction, the more the star's quality saturates the planet it touches.

A few of the most telling conjunctions, drawn from the symbolic logic of this star:

  • Sun conjunct Kaus Media brings sociability and a naturally optimistic disposition, along with a potentially supportive relationship with the father figure — a white karma, as Bartolucci frames it, meaning a constructive inheritance rather than a burden to resolve.

  • Moon conjunct Kaus Media links social success to Saturnian cycles — it will come, but not quickly, and the soul must cultivate patience as a genuine practice rather than a mere virtue.

  • Mercury conjunct Kaus Media orients the mind toward law, philosophy, and the architecture of ideas. There may also be a karmic dimension around children — a soul that chose the experience of parenthood but finds it unexpectedly difficult to realise.

  • Mars conjunct Kaus Media intensifies the star's tribal-leader resonance most directly, since Mars is already one of its planetary rulers. The invitation here is to assume responsibility across every domain of life — not to seek power, but to stop refusing it.

  • Saturn conjunct Kaus Media points to a fundamental challenge in managing life-force energy. The native may need to find a physical discipline — a martial art, a demanding sport, a rigorous practice — to learn how to regulate and deploy their vitality rather than dissipate or suppress it.

  • Neptune conjunct Kaus Media introduces a particular vulnerability: spiritual naïvety, a tendency to invest belief too readily in teachings or groups that cannot bear the weight of that faith. The star's Air element and its demand for clear reasoning become especially important here.

The Soul's Curriculum

Across the lunar mansion traditions that Bartolucci maps onto this star, a consistent theme emerges. The Hebrew mansion Thiah speaks of the finality of all things — an incarnational purpose connected to invisible masters, to guidance that arrives from beyond the visible world. The Hindu mansion Uttarashadha, the Later Victorious One, links the star to angelic contact and a dialogue with the unseen — but it also warns against the spiritual ego, the search for adulation dressed as devotion.

The soul carrying this star is working on forgiveness — of others, and perhaps more crucially, of itself. Breadth of spirit and genuine tolerance are not natural gifts here so much as they are the curriculum: the qualities that must be built through friction, through the moments when it would be easier to contract than to open.

There is a structural tension built into Kaus Media: it is simultaneously a star of culmination and ambition and a star that asks for energetic economy. The forces available may not be unlimited. Spending them carelessly, in the pursuit of recognition or in the suppression of inner conflict, depletes the very resource the star requires. The image of the archer is instructive — the bow is drawn, the breath is held, the aim is refined. Only then is the arrow released. The star rewards those who learn when to wait.

The lunar angel associated with this star in Bartolucci's system is Géliel, whose domain is the restoration and preservation of family harmony — the resolution of karmic knots within the lineage. Where Kaus Media is active in a chart, the family field is rarely neutral ground.
